SCOTUS Hears TikTok’s Case | Bloomberg Technology

Bloomberg’s Caroline Hyde takes a deep dive into the impact of TikTok’s potential US ban as the Supreme Court hears TikTok’s appeal. And, we speak with Project Liberty founder Frank McCourt Jr. on his bid for purchasing the social media platform. Even if you’re not a gardener, its time to get your hands a little dirty #TEDTalks

Many gardeners work hard to maintain clean, tidy environments … which is the exact opposite of what wildlife wants, says ecological horticulturist Rebecca McMackin. She shows the beauty of letting your garden run wild, surveying the success she’s had increasing biodiversity even in the middle of New York City — and offers tips for cultivating…

How I Created OpenClaw, the Breakthrough AI Agent | Peter Steinberger | TED

OpenClaw creator Peter Steinberger takes us back to the transformative moment he let his AI agent loose on the internet, igniting one of the world’s fastest-growing open-source projects. He makes a fascinating (and slightly unnerving) case that agents are a real shift, not just better versions of chatbots, and explores how they might reshape your…

Arm CEO on Proposed California Wealth Tax: Not a Good Thing

Arm CEO Rene Haas warns a proposed wealth tax in California could drive top entrepreneurs out of Silicon Valley. “I don’t think it’s a good thing if it drives really smart people outside the valley,” Haas tells Bloomberg’s Tom Mackenzie.
